Income in Commissioners Creek

What people and households earn each week, and how incomes are spread.

Nearly 29% of people in Commissioners Creek earn under $650 a week, marking it as a low-income area. The typical household earns well below the state and national figures, with family incomes falling significantly short of the New South Wales average.

Typical incomes

Median personal, family and household incomes.

The typical family here earns $1,625 a week, which is well below the New South Wales figure of $2,185. Household income is also much lower than most areas at $1,375, though personal weekly income of $754 is about the same as the national figure.

Income spread

High earners and the full distribution.

Income is spread heavily toward the lower end, with no one in the area earning $1,500 or more per week. This is far below the New South Wales average, where 13.5% of people earn over $2,000 weekly.
